Output df8afc0616bf9298dff0330cd5b713d3d7d376cb4478e98ab3eceac51d8d86cf:1

value
42879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f5e0d301442a59de6c9e6af88265deb50a1ac6 OP_EQUAL
address
3Atr3eN2xtAgk2T2RQpmybv2LZLbapF2jD
transaction
df8afc0616bf9298dff0330cd5b713d3d7d376cb4478e98ab3eceac51d8d86cf
confirmations
386890
spent
true